examples of percentages are: 10% is equal to 1/10 fraction 20% is equivalent to ⅕ fraction 25% is equivalent to ¼ fraction 50% is equivalent to ½ fraction 75% is equivalent to ¾ fraction 90% is equivalent to 9/10 fraction percentages have no dimension. hence it is called a...
